In many threads, quotes of other users' prior posts can become so long that they take more than 3/4ths of each post just to repeat what the other users have said. I know text can just be deleted to save space, but sometimes having the full context is helpful to catch up with the discussion.

Is there some way to collapse text into a drop-down or behind a spoiler that shrinks it until clicked? I know a lot of folks just "-snip-" to cut down on the length of their posts, but is there another, cleaner way to achieve this?

You can't collapse other posters' writing without abusing the ignore function (which will throw you back to the start of the thread anyway).

You can collapse your own text, however, using the spoiler function. I've found this can be a useful tool if you're posting a wall of text (sometimes relevant for streams of data on election nights).

Also, if you're writing a long post, and want to avoid clogging up the post, using the spoiler headings as chapter titles can allow you to keep the long-post easily navigatable.

If you open the "quote" option on this post you can see the relevant bbcode below:
